Biography

US Black Heritage Project
Celestine Beuben is a part of US Black heritage.

Celestine Beuben was born about 1844 in New York. She was raised and educated in the Colored Orphans Asylum in New York, New York.

Education

In 1850, she is attending school at the orphanage. Two of the orphanages six on-site teachers that year were women of color: 47-year-old Jane Stout and 20-year-old Mary A. Boder. The orphanage's matron was 40-year-old Susan Benedict who may have been a white Quaker.

Residence

1850: Colored Orphans Asylum, New York, New York

Sources

  • 1850 United States Federal Census Year: 1850; Census Place: New York Ward 19, New York, New York; Roll: M432_559; Page: 146B; Image: 298
